Robotic Surgery for Kidney Cancer

In the past, kidney cancer surgeries required large incisions and lengthy hospital stays. However, with the introduction of the DaVinci Robotic System, patients can now experience quicker recovery times and reduced pain. Dr. Fynes uses the robotic system to perform both total and partial nephrectomies. Total nephrectomies involve the removal of the entire kidney, while partial nephrectomies allow for the removal of only the tumor, preserving the healthy kidney tissue.

Enhanced Visualization and Precision

One of the key benefits of the DaVinci Robotic System is the improved visualization it provides during surgery. The system magnifies the surgical field, allowing Dr. Fynes to perform precise dissections and remove tumors with greater accuracy. This enhanced visualization is particularly beneficial for partial nephrectomies, where it is crucial to separate the tumor from the healthy kidney tissue without causing damage.

Reduced Pain and Faster Recovery

Robotic-assisted surgery with the DaVinci Robotic System is significantly less painful for patients compared to traditional open procedures. The smaller incisions used in robotic surgery result in less blood loss, reduced pain, and faster healing. As a result, patients can return home and resume their normal activities much sooner. According to Dr. Fynes, patients who undergo robotic-assisted kidney cancer surgery are typically discharged from the hospital in just two or three days, compared to five to seven days for traditional open procedures.
